When I received my Sale-A-Bration freebies, I was very much intrigued by the Irresistibly Yours DSP. You can earn this pack of 12x12 DSP (6 sheets, 2 designs of each) for FREE with a $50 order. This paper is fantastic! It is all white paper with glossy white patterns and it is perfect for a variety of coloring techniques. Coloring reveals the pattern!


There are a variety of ways to color this paper, but today I am showcasing using the method of sponge daubing and sponging. I started with wiping with a sponge a layer of Wild Wasabi ink over the entire piece of DSP. This gave it a "base layer" of ink.

I wanted some accents of Garden Green ink, so I used my sponge daubers to also wipe over the DSP until I got the look I wanted. You could also just use a sponge again if you wanted to!

After inking the DSP, I used a tissue to wipe off the glossy leaves of the paper. I really didn't need to do this step for these particular colors, but sometimes you will need to wipe clean the white glossy part of the paper to get rid of the ink. Most of it was already gone anyway.

This picture shows you a better view of the glossy leaves. It's so beautiful in person!

My finished card! I paired up the Hello You Thinlits with the Crazy About You stamp set. I am loving the combination of Pink Pirouette, Melon Mambo, and Garden Green together!! The flower from the Crazy About You set was stamped in both Melon Mambo and Pink Pirouette on scraps of Whisper White and then I used my Paper Snips to cut them apart and then layered them on top of each other, ending with a Pink Pirouette candy dot in the middle. To add dimension, each layer is popped up with a Dimensional.

With my next card I used the painter's tape technique to color stripes onto the polka dotted Irresistibly Yours DSP. First I masked up the card with 5 different lines of tape, leaving just a little bit in between each one. I left the bottom stripe unmasked and then sponged/wiped with my first color (Bermuda Bay).

After that I moved the second piece of tape down to the bottom and then sponged/wiped with my second color...and so on.

Here is the fun effect it made! After all the colors were sponged, I stamped a giant image in the middle (with an extra "celebrate" banner that I stamped and cut out separately). I did have to wipe the black ink from the sentiment away from the glossy dots. I added some random rhinestones for some extra bling! I have a friend who should be getting this card in the mail soon! I used Bermuda Bay, Pistachio Pudding, Coastal Cabana, So Saffron, and Calypso Coral.

My last card I didn't take a picture of my process, but after seeing the first two cards you can kind of get the idea of how this sponging/wiping technique works. I think this is my favorite of the three! I used 4 different shades of blue and wiped the sponge diagonally across the card color after color so the blended with each other. I used Softy Sky, Marina Mist, Island Indigo, and Night of Navy. I just kept sponging and wiping until I got the desired look I was hoping for. It really looks like a starry night. I finished the card off with a simple balloon from the Celebrate Today stamp set. I tied a piece of Soft Sky Cotton Twine around the card and tied a bow at the base of the balloon. Perfect for a masculine birthday card!
